Competing at his fifth and final Olympics, Shaun White doesn’t have the sponsorship portfolio he once did, but he can still command six figures annually with his deals.

But perhaps no athlete at this year’s Beijing Games is identified as closely with their sport as White, who has piled up three gold medals at the Winter Olympics and 13 at the Winter X Games while hoisting himself into the conversation of all-time sports greats. That popularity ensures that White, who signed his first endorsement deal with Burton Snowboards at age 7, continues to have a hold on brands nearly 30 years later as he prepares to compete at his fifth Olympics.

White, a native of Carlsbad, California, who underwent a pair of open heart surgeries before his first birthday to correct a congenital defect, burst on the scene in 2002 by capturing two silver medals at the X Games. From there, he went on an unprecedented run of success, winning a total of 23 X Games medals, including five in skateboarding at the summer edition of the event.
